Wired je americký časopis, zaměřující se na dopady nových a rozvíjejících se technologií na kulturu, hospodářství a politiku. Je vlastněn společností Condé Nast, sídlí v San Francisku v Kalifornii a je publikován od března 1993. Vychází v tištěné a elektronické podobě.
